Job title: Total Rewards Analyst – 6 month contract

Business Segment: Human Resources

Location: Poland, Czech Republic, Hungary, Spain

 

The Total Rewards Analyst plays a critical role in supporting the Total Rewards team in a variety of operational tasks and initiatives such as job architecture, global digitisation projects, salary structure development, and digitised annual compensation cycles.

 

Your Mission:

  • Perform global compensation benchmarking and market pricing using global survey data.
  • Support on building salary ranges aligned to the new Job Framework.
  • Support the compensation data digitisation project with data consolidation, validation and mass uploads.
  • Support the annual compensation process where required.
  • Support administration of the annual bonus cash plan.
  • Support reporting requirements including creating standard reports for HR/Manager use.
  • Regular validation of bonus and salary data informing local HR and/or assisting with correction in SuccessFactors
  • Lead and submit salary survey submissions

 

Your Profile:

  • 2+ years in Compensation/Total Rewards with global or multi-country scope preferred
  • Exceptional analytical and data governance capability
  • Experience in salary range design and benchmarking methodology
  • Hands-on exposures to HRIS/comp systems (ideally SuccessFactors)
  • Detail-oriented, disciplined and execution-focused working style
  • Proficient in written and spoken English
  • German and/or other language would be an advantage
